Regulatory Compliance:- Ensure compliance with local, national, and international EHS regulations (e.g., OSHA, EPA, FDA, ISO 14001, ISO 45001). Maintain all necessary permits, licenses, and documentation. Serve as the point of contact for regulatory agencies and audits. Monitor and ensure compliance with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) and EHS guidelines relevant to pharmaceuticals. Safety Program Development & Implementation Develop, implement, and maintain site-specific safety programs, procedures, and training. Conduct risk assessments, HAZOPs, and Job Safety Analyses (JSA). Manage chemical safety programs, including handling of hazardous drugs, solvents, and waste. Promote Behavior-Based Safety (BBS) and conduct regular safety observations. Incident Investigation & Reporting Lead or support the investigation of incidents, near misses, and occupational illnesses. Perform root cause analysis and implement corrective/preventive actions. Maintain and analyze incident metrics and reports. Environmental Management Oversee waste management, including hazardous and biomedical waste disposal. Monitor air emissions, water discharges, and chemical storage. Implement pollution prevention and resource conservation initiatives. Health Management Monitor employee exposure to chemicals, noise, and other workplace hazards. Collaborate with occupational health professionals for regular health surveillance. Emergency Preparedness Develop and implement emergency response and disaster preparedness plans. Conduct regular emergency drills (fire, chemical spills, evacuation). Maintain and inspect emergency equipment (e.g., eyewash stations, spill kits). Training & Communication Provide regular EHS training for employees, contractors, and visitors. Maintain training records and ensure training is up-to-date. Promote safety awareness through communication campaigns, safety committees, and toolbox talks. Leadership & Culture Lead the EHS team and collaborate cross-functionally with production, maintenance, QA/QC, and HR departments. Foster a culture of accountability and safety ownership at all levels. Serve as a mentor and coach on EHS matters. Audits and Inspections Conduct regular internal EHS audits and inspections. Prepare for and manage external inspections or audits by regulators and corporate EHS teams.

Essential functions of the position Handling all Emergencies during plant operations. Ensure all Fixed and Portable Fire Protection System are healthy and ready to use Ensure fire water pumps are inspected & maintained regularly. Ensure fire fighting vehicles are operational during all the times. Ensure fire team is trained to handle emergency conditions & imparting routine drills to the fire crew on various emergencies. Attend Mock drills, Fire Safety Audit, OISD audit, Third party Inspection audit Attend any breakdown related to Fixed, Mobile and Portable firefighting system. Ensure availability of various fire fighting equipment spares as per the site conditions Impart HSEF training to IOLPL Employee and Contract workers. Exposure to maintenance of fire pumps and other fire fighting equipment Essential Skills and Experience 1.Fire fighting systems operation and maintenance 2. Handling Fire crew on a day to day basis 3. HSEF Training of the workforce. 4. Exposure to working in hydrocarbon industries preferably LNG/LPG/Refineries/Petrochemicals/Fertilizers taking care of Fire protection related jobs. Preference in experience 1. Experience in any process plant/terminal. 2. Should have hands on experience in manning a fire station having a minimum of 8 fire crew members. 3. Should have basic knowledge on the OISD, NFPA standards pertaining to fire fighting, fire protections. 4. Should possess valid Heavy license. Essential Qualification Full Time Graduate in any discipline & Diploma in Fire & Safety / Diploma in Industrial Safety (3 years)/BSc in Fire & Safety with Minimum 60% marks (or equivalent CGPA) from a recognized University / Institute approved by AICTE.
